Overview

This Notion skill has a coherent purpose, but it requests live workspace read/write access while giving inconsistent privacy, OAuth, and user-control guidance.

Review this carefully before installing. Use it only with a Notion integration limited to the specific pages or databases you intend to manage, avoid broad workspace permissions, and require manual confirmation before any create or update action. Do not rely on the local-only privacy claim unless the publisher clarifies exactly what is sent to Notion, what is cached locally, and how OAuth credentials are stored and revoked.

Findings (4)

Description-Behavior Mismatch

High
Confidence
96% confidence
Finding
The skill claims that FREE-version data is stored locally and not uploaded to the cloud, yet elsewhere it requires OAuth connection to a Notion account and notes that some functions need external API/network access. This creates a misleading security assurance that may cause users to expose workspace data under false assumptions about data flow and trust boundaries.

Intent-Code Divergence

Medium
Confidence
89% confidence
Finding
The documentation presents OAuth credential management as a PRO-only feature, but FREE-version setup and FAQ instruct users to authenticate via OAuth. This inconsistency can mislead users about available security controls and credential-handling behavior, increasing the risk of improper deployment or mistaken trust in edition-specific protections.

Vague Triggers

Medium
Confidence
84% confidence
Finding
The trigger conditions say to use the skill for broad needs like data analysis, reporting, statistics, and visualization, which exceed the stated Notion page/database management scope. Ambiguous invocation boundaries increase the chance an agent will route unrelated or overly sensitive tasks to this skill, leading to unintended data access or misuse of write-capable actions.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
91% confidence
Finding
The skill advertises creation and update capabilities for Notion pages and properties but does not clearly warn users that these are state-changing operations. In an agent-driven context, missing modification warnings and confirmation requirements can lead to accidental overwrites, unwanted content changes, or integrity loss in a user's workspace.
